In the UK's Executive Development Programme for climate-conscious art advocacy, professionals work in various roles, each with a unique focus on promoting sustainability in the arts sector. The 3D pie chart below demonstrates the distribution of professionals in different roles: 1. **Curators** (25%): Curators drive the narrative behind climate-conscious art exhibitions, ensuring that they raise awareness about environmental issues. 2. **Art Directors** (20%): Art directors collaborate with curators and designers to create visually appealing and sustainable art installations. 3. **Exhibition Designers** (15%): Exhibition designers plan and construct eco-friendly spaces for art displays, incorporating sustainable materials and practices. 4. **Art Advisors** (10%): Art advisors provide guidance on acquiring and managing art collections with a focus on climate-conscious artists and works. 5. **Conservators** (10%): Conservators restore and preserve art pieces while ensuring minimal environmental impact through sustainable methods. 6. **Art Educators** (10%): Art educators teach students and visitors about climate change and its impact on the art world, fostering a culture of eco-consciousness. 7. **Art Technicians** (10%): Art technicians assist with the installation, maintenance, and storage of climate-conscious artworks, incorporating sustainable practices in their tasks.
